The Oshode hairstyle is a distinctive and culturally rich look originating from the Fulani people of West Africa. It involves meticulous cornrows braided close to the scalp, often arranged in geometric or linear patterns that highlight the natural curl definition. What sets Oshode apart is its adornment with beads, typically added along the braids for decorative and symbolic purposes, reflecting Fulani heritage. This style is chosen by individuals seeking to celebrate their cultural roots, enhance their natural texture, or make a fashion statement with intricate detailing.
